Head-to-Head: Bulma vs Spectre.css Analysis

bulma

v0.9.4(almost 2 years ago)

This package was last published over a year ago. It may not be actively maintained.The package doesn't have any types definitionsNumber of direct dependencies: 0Monthly npm downloads

Bulma is a modern and lightweight CSS framework that provides a set of responsive and customizable UI components. It follows a mobile-first approach and is designed to be easy to use and highly flexible. With Bulma, you can quickly build professional-looking websites and web applications with minimal effort.

Alternatives:
tailwindcss+
bootstrap+
foundation-sites+
tachyons+
skeleton+
milligram+
spectre.css+
semantic-ui-css+
uikit+
primer-css+

Tags: cssframeworkresponsivecustomizableui-components

spectre.css

v0.5.9(over 3 years ago)

This package was last published over a year ago. It may not be actively maintained.The package doesn't have any types definitionsNumber of direct dependencies: 0Monthly npm downloads

Spectre.css is a lightweight and responsive CSS framework for building modern and beautiful websites. It provides a set of well-designed and customizable components, such as grids, buttons, forms, and navigation, that can be easily integrated into your project. Spectre.css follows a mobile-first approach, ensuring that your website looks great on all devices.

Alternatives:
bulma+
tailwindcss+
bootstrap+
foundation-sites+
tachyons+
uikit+
milligram+
purecss+
picnic+
primer-css+

Tags: cssframeworkresponsivecomponentsminimalist

Fight!

Popularity

Both Bulma and Spectre.css are popular CSS frameworks, but Bulma has a larger user base and is more widely adopted in the web development community. It has been around for longer and has a larger ecosystem of plugins and extensions.

Design and Customization

Bulma provides a clean and modern design with a wide range of pre-built components and utility classes. It offers a high level of customization through Sass variables and allows you to easily modify the look and feel of your project. Spectre.css, on the other hand, has a minimalist design and focuses on simplicity. It provides a smaller set of components and utility classes, but still offers enough flexibility for most projects.

Size and Performance

Spectre.css is a lightweight CSS framework, with a smaller file size compared to Bulma. It aims to be performant and efficient, resulting in faster load times. Bulma, while larger in size, offers more features and components, which may be beneficial for larger projects or those requiring extensive customization.

Documentation and Community Support

Bulma has comprehensive documentation with clear examples and a large community of users. It has a dedicated website with detailed guides and resources. Spectre.css also has good documentation, although it may not be as extensive as Bulma's. Both frameworks have active communities and provide support through forums and GitHub repositories.

Integration with JavaScript Frameworks

Both Bulma and Spectre.css can be easily integrated with popular JavaScript frameworks like React, Vue.js, and Angular. They provide CSS classes and components that can be used alongside these frameworks without any issues.

Browser Compatibility

Both frameworks are designed to be compatible with modern browsers and provide fallbacks for older versions. However, Bulma has been around for longer and has been thoroughly tested across a wider range of browsers, making it slightly more reliable in terms of cross-browser compatibility.